"Angelo Mariani was considered at that time the prince director, the genius director! The Italian orchestra, under him, had in fact transformed. Before Mariani, the conductors, even the most talented, had limited themselves to obtaining accuracy, balance, intonation from the orchestra, i.e. the qualities indispensable for a good performance. With him the orchestra suddenly elevated itself to the mission of interpreter, of true collaborator of the author's thoughts and feelings. (Gino Monaldi)"
